Abstract
A method for communicating process data between a plurality of devices in a process control system, including receiving process data in an equipment interface system data format from an equipment interface system, and selecting a set of the process data received from the equipment interface system for communication to a process data control system. The method also includes configuring the selected set of process data from the equipment interface system data format into an open format for communication to the process data control system, and transmitting the configured process data to the process data control system.
